探索低代码开发工具,一种新兴的软件开发模式,它通过简化编程流程和提供可视化界面,使得非专业开发人员也能快速构建应用程序。这种工具的核心优势在于降低技术门槛、缩短开发周期、提高开发效率等。以下是对低代码开发工具的详细分析:
1. 降低技术门槛
- 减少编码工作量:低代码平台通过预制的组件和模板,大幅减少了编码工作量,使得开发者可以专注于业务逻辑的实现。
- 用户友好的界面:低代码平台通常提供直观的用户界面,使得即使是没有编程背景的业务人员也能通过简单的培训掌握应用开发技能。
2. 缩短开发周期
- 快速原型开发:低代码平台允许开发者快速构建原型,进行测试和迭代,从而加速产品开发流程。
- 跨学科协作:低代码平台促进了不同背景团队成员的协作,提高了项目的灵活性和创新能力。
3. 提高开发效率
- 模型驱动的开发方式:低代码平台采用模型驱动的方式,将复杂的业务逻辑抽象成可复用的模块,提高了开发效率。
- 可编程的可视化开发:低代码平台提供了可编程的可视化开发方式,使得开发者能够根据需求灵活配置和应用功能。
4. 提升开发质量
- 减少错误:通过图形化编程界面,减少了代码错误,提高了代码的可读性和可维护性。
- 易于部署和维护:低代码平台通常提供完整的部署和管理工具,使得应用的维护和升级更加便捷。
5. 降低成本
- 降低人力成本:低代码平台的使用降低了对专业开发人员的需求,从而降低了人力成本。
- 减少培训成本:非专业人员通过简单的培训就能使用低代码平台,减少了培训成本。
6. 适应快速发展的市场
- 快速响应市场变化:低代码平台能够快速响应市场变化,帮助企业快速开发出满足市场需求的应用。
- 创新加速:低代码平台鼓励跨学科合作和创新思维,有助于推动新技术和新应用的发展。
7. 支持多种应用场景
- 企业级应用:低代码平台适用于各种复杂管理系统的开发,如WMS系统、ERP系统等。
- 移动应用开发:低代码平台同样适用于移动应用的开发,使得开发者能够快速构建跨平台的移动应用。
8. 促进数字化转型
- 加速数字化转型:低代码平台是数字化转型的重要工具,能够帮助企业快速实现数字化升级。
- 提高数据利用效率:通过低代码平台,企业可以更高效地管理和分析数据,提高数据利用效率。
此外,在了解以上内容后,以下还有一些其他建议:
- 在选择低代码平台时,应考虑平台的成熟度、社区支持、生态系统以及是否提供持续的更新和技术支持。
- 对于大型企业或需要高度定制化需求的项目,可能需要考虑与专业的软件开发团队合作,以确保最终产品的质量。
- 随着技术的不断发展,低代码平台的功能和性能也在不断提升,因此保持关注行业动态和技术发展趋势是非常重要的。
总的来说,低代码开发工具为软件开发带来了革命性的变化,它通过简化编程流程和提供可视化界面,使得非专业开发人员也能快速构建应用程序。这种工具的核心优势在于降低技术门槛、缩短开发周期、提高开发效率等。